Frances Gerard
Submitted by Jack W. James

Anoter of Fort Smith's oldest citizens, died on Saturday morning last at the home of her son, Edward, near Lavaca, aged nearly 74 years. "Grandma" Gerard was well known to all old citizens here, but for many years has resided with her son, where she died. Deceased came to Fort Smith about fifty-two years ago, and during a large portion of her life kept a confectionery establishment on Water street. Her remains were brought to this sicty, and on Sunday was witnessed a
TRIPPLE FUNERAL
at the Catholic cemetery, Mr. McBride, Mrs Keating and Mrs. Gerard all being buried at the same time, the three hearses being followed from the Catholic church to the cemetery by a long procession of vehicles occupied by the sorrowing relatives and friends of the three departed ones.
